Gerald (Jerry) Hulon Mann, 88, of Royal Palm Beach, passed away Saturday, October 20, 2007. Jerry was born in Senoia, GA and was the 5th child of James H. Mann & Katie Mae Ballard. After high school, he started working for Walgreen?s in 1941 and retired from there in 1977. He was an Army WWII Veteran, where he served in the Philippines under Gen. Douglas MacArthur. During 1946, in Miami, FL., Jerry met his future wife of 59 years Anna Clark and they married in 1948. He was an avid fisherman, loved camping, and was a big Atlanta Braves fan.
